Design Considerations

galley kitchen design with small antique wood island When it comes to the design of a galley kitchen, there are several considerations that need to be taken into account. First and foremost, assess the available space . Consider not only the size of the kitchen, but also the amount of space you have available for the island. The island should also fit in with the other elements of the kitchen such as the color scheme, cabinetry and appliances. It is also important to consider the functionality of the island. Different activities may be best facilitated by the particular size and shape of the island. For instance, if you want to use the island for cooking or meal preparation, then a longer and narrower island can be more effective than a square or round island.

Feature Ideas

galley kitchen design with small antique wood island An antique wood island can feature a range of drawers, shelves and cupboards, as well as plenty of counter space. Counter space can range from a standard countertop to a sink for washing vegetables or a small cooking area. Islands can also include features such as seating areas , shelving, bookshelves or a snack bar. When it comes to individual features, one particularly beautiful addition can be custom-made butcher’s block countertops. You can also opt for open shelving or cupboards to add contrast to the sleek design of the galley kitchen.
